Description TakeCare offers instant online health advice and consultations from qualified pharmacists. It provides quick, affordable guidance for minor ailments and general health queries, directly connecting users with professional medical insights. Tinygains is an AI-powered habit tracking platform primarily available as a mobile application, designed to empower users in building and sustaining positive routines. It leverages artificial intelligence to offer personalized suggestions, intelligent reminders, and visual progress tracking, fostering consistency and facilitating effective personal growth. The tool focuses on the principle of 'tiny gains,' emphasizing small, consistent actions that compound over time to achieve significant self-improvement goals.
What It Does Facilitates online consultations, connecting users with pharmacists for immediate, professional health advice and support for various health concerns. Tinygains helps users define, track, and grow their habits by providing an intuitive interface for daily check-ins and progress monitoring. It uses AI to analyze user behavior and goals, delivering tailored advice and timely notifications to keep them on track. The platform visualizes streaks and achievements, motivating users to maintain consistency and build lasting routines.
